For our client, we are seeking a Product Manager III Golf to join the team of a leader in the Information Technology space. This role will shape product priorities that connect customer needs, business goals, and practical execution. You will partner with engineering, design, analytics, and go-to-market teams to define opportunities, prioritize work, and deliver measurable product outcomes. The position offers the opportunity to influence roadmap direction while improving customer experience and business performance within a technology-driven environment.
Location: Remote - US based candidates only, no visa sponsorship available
Compensation: $140,000 – $150,000 annually
Responsibilities
Craft feature and scope definitions balancing customer and business perspectives
Gather insights from customers and market trends to shape product direction
Create clear product delivery plans in collaboration with technical teams
Drive implementation and execution of the product roadmap
Coordinate successful product launches with Go-to-Market teams
Define and report on product success metrics
Build trusted relationships with both internal and external stakeholders
Qualifications
Bachelor's degree
5+ years of experience in product management, especially in B2B software or club management software
Proven expertise in leading cross-functional teams and executing product roadmaps
Excellent communication and leadership skills for diverse audiences
Passion for enhancing user experiences through technology
Collaborative mindset to influence and lead teams
Experience in Agile/Scrum development life cycles
